Lines Matching refs:P5
4476 template <class R, class P1, class P2, class P3, class P4, class P5,
4477 R F(P1, P2, P3, P4, P5), class I>
4481 static R Call(P1 p1, P2 p2, P3 p3, P4 p4, P5 p5) {
4524 template <class R, class P1, class P2, class P3, class P4, class P5,
4525 R F(P1, P2, P3, P4, P5), class I>
4589 template <class R, class P1, class P2, class P3, class P4, class P5>
4591 template <R F(P1, P2, P3, P4, P5)>
4592 Func5<R, P1, P2, P3, P4, P5, F, FuncInfo<P1, R> > GetFunc() {
4593 return Func5<R, P1, P2, P3, P4, P5, F, FuncInfo<P1, R> >();
4596 template <R F(P1, P2, P3, P4, P5)>
4597 BoundFunc5<R, P1, P2, P3, P4, P5, F, FuncInfo<P1, R> > GetFunc(
4599 return BoundFunc5<R, P1, P2, P3, P4, P5, F, FuncInfo<P1, R> >(param2);
4629 template <class R, class P1, class P2, class P3, class P4, class P5>
4630 inline FuncSig5<R, P1, P2, P3, P4, P5> MatchFunc(R (*f)(P1, P2, P3, P4, P5)) {
4632 return FuncSig5<R, P1, P2, P3, P4, P5>();
4997 template <class R, class P1, class P2, class P3, class P4, class P5,
4998 R F(P1, P2, P3, P4, P5)>
4999 R CastHandlerData5(void *c, const void *hd, P3 p3, P4 p4, P5 p5) {
5065 template <class R, class P1, class P2, class P3, class P4, class P5,
5066 R F(P1, P2, P3, P4, P5), class I, class T>
5067 struct ConvertParams<BoundFunc5<R, P1, P2, P3, P4, P5, F, I>, T> {
5068 typedef Func5<R, void *, const void *, P3, P4, P5,
5069 CastHandlerData5<R, P1, P2, P3, P4, P5, F>, I> Func;
5127 template <class R, class P1, class P2, class P3, class P4, class P5>
5128 struct ReturnOf<R (*)(P1, P2, P3, P4, P5)> {